This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2021-09-24
Channels
- # announcements (30)
- # asami (9)
- # babashka (37)
- # beginners (120)
- # calva (26)
- # cider (3)
- # clara (9)
- # clj-commons (7)
- # clj-kondo (17)
- # cljsrn (2)
- # clojure (32)
- # clojure-europe (56)
- # clojure-nl (1)
- # clojure-norway (13)
- # clojure-uk (4)
- # clojurescript (34)
- # conjure (1)
- # copenhagen-clojurians (8)
- # core-async (21)
- # cursive (2)
- # datahike (2)
- # datascript (5)
- # events (4)
- # fulcro (32)
- # graalvm (10)
- # heroku (3)
- # introduce-yourself (1)
- # jobs (2)
- # lsp (3)
- # luminus (1)
- # malli (8)
- # meander (15)
- # minecraft (1)
- # nrepl (2)
- # off-topic (57)
- # pathom (2)
- # polylith (35)
- # reagent (6)
- # reitit (8)
- # releases (1)
- # rewrite-clj (7)
- # shadow-cljs (21)
- # timbre (4)
- # tools-build (1)
- # tools-deps (33)
- # vrac (8)
Hey @wilkerlucio, I was prototyping ideas with pathom3, using a :pathom/as
alias plugin, and I end up in a cache issue
There is something that I can do to avoid cache in that case? I tried ::pcr/resolver-cache* nil
and (reify p.cache/CacheStore (-cache-lookup-or-miss [this k f] (f)))
https://gist.github.com/souenzzo/ff7bda87108cb51adc5f7db4aa367b6e
on a first sight, I think this is more complicated than that, it has to do with the way the planner works, you can’t have the same attribute twice, that get’s collapsed in a single call, this could change in the future, but for now its a limitation